Is it normal to want to eat 'normally'?

I used to be super overweight (175 lbs and 5 feet nothing) and I started dieting by calorie counting for awhile which turned super unhealthy in the long run because I battle with myself about eating 'too much' but often i'm eating too little I suppose. I have restricted myself down to 1200 calories a day and weigh about 130 lbs and i'm 5 feet 1 inch now. Most of the time though I just want to eat food without worrying about the calories or measuring it out yet I feel like if I do i'll get fat again. Is this normal?

    I'd say it's normal it's normal to not want to worry about what your eating, but some people are more prone to weight gain then others. You should try and look at different ways of dieting then just calorie counting. you can try focusing more on what it is your eating, 500 cals of meat or pasta is way less food then 500 cals of veggies and fruit. It's also helpful to have multiple smaller meals throughout the day rather then few large meals.

    If you feel like you struggle with beating yourself up over eating to much or to little. Then talk to someone, it's easy to cross the line of trying to eat healthy to forming a disorder without noticing.
